CVE-2021-32964 describes a path traversal vulnerability in AGG Software Web Server versions 4.0.40.1014 and earlier, allowing an unauthenticated attacker to read arbitrary files from the file system. This medium-severity vulnerability has a CVSS score of 5.3, indicating a low impact on confidentiality and no impact on integrity or availability, with low attack complexity and no user interaction required. There is currently no evidence of active exploitation, public exploit code, or significant community discussion, suggesting a low immediate threat.
